Senior Audiologist and Clinical Services Director

Dr. Baldwin has been with Associated Audiologists for more than a decade. She is a clinical assistant professor and has an ad hoc graduate faculty appointment at the University of Kansas Medical Center, where she has taught audiology coursework and provides clinical instruction for students.

Dr. Baldwin is a member of the Academy of Doctors of Audiology (ADA), holds a certificate of clinical competence in audiology from the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association (ASHA), and is a member of the Kansas Speech-Language-Hearing Association (KSHA). She earned her Doctorate of Audiology degree from the University of Kansas. Dr. Baldwin coordinates the staff’s efforts for all local and national legislative issues that pertain to our patients, providers, practice and the profession of audiology and she serves as the Audiology Legislative Liaison for KSHA.
